I want to either go to a different Bible study group within my church or go to another study group outside my church.

How should I go about telling my current group that I will no longer be joining them?
Go to or call the group leader and share with her that you feel it's time to move on. Let her know how much you've learned from everyone and how much you are taking with you as you follow God with the rest of the journey that He has for you.

Everyone moves on. It's the cycle of life. Just let everyone know how much you are going to miss them and to please keep the door open for you to come back for visits, fellowship and prayer.

Give a thank you card to each one with a hand written note sharing how much you appreciate each of them. OR.... If you like, you can also take cupcakes to your last meeting with them with the thank you notes.

You could even type a huge 'Thank You' on some nice stationery, frame it and sign it with love. :love3: When it's time to go, it's simply time to go. No one should ever stop you from moving on with God.
